SGDM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2025 in Review

78 of the 7,459 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Sprott Gold Miners ETF (SGDM) for Q1 2025, worth a combined $84.4M — up 36% from $62.2M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 12 funds opened new SGDM positions and 9 closed out — a net gain of 3 holders — while 17 added to existing stakes and 18 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Riggs Asset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$3.08M. The largest seller was Sprott Inc, cutting an estimated $2.11M.
